一种阻塞性睡眠呼吸暂停非手术治疗方法的效果。舌托装置。

The effects of a nonsurgical treatment for obstructive sleep apnea. The tongue-retaining device.

作者信息

Cartwright R D, Samelson C F

出版信息

JAMA. 1982 Aug 13;248(6):705-9.

PMID:7097922
Abstract

The tongue-retaining device (TRD) was designed to increase the unobstructed dimension of the nasal breathing passage during sleep. Twenty male patients with diagnoses of sleep apnea syndrome, primarily of the obstructive type, confirmed by clinical polysomnography, were fitted with the device. The TRD holds the tongue in a forward position by negative pressure. Fourteen patients have been tested before and after this treatment, and ten of these have also completed two follow-up recordings four to six months after being trained in the use of this device. There was significantly improved sleep and significantly fewer and shorter apneic events on all nights when the device was worn. On the first night of wearing the TRD for a half night only, there was a significant reduction in the number of obstructive and central apneic episodes. The mean apnea plus hypopnea index while wearing the TRD is comparable with the rate reported for patients who have been treated surgically by either tracheostomy or by uvulopalatopharyngoplasty, although the tracheostomy group contained more severe cases.

摘要

舌保持装置(TRD)旨在增加睡眠期间鼻腔呼吸通道的通畅尺寸。通过临床多导睡眠图确诊为睡眠呼吸暂停综合征(主要为阻塞型)的20名男性患者佩戴了该装置。TRD通过负压将舌头保持在向前位置。14名患者在该治疗前后进行了测试,其中10名患者在接受该装置使用培训四至六个月后还完成了两次随访记录。佩戴该装置的所有夜晚,睡眠均有显著改善,呼吸暂停事件显著减少且持续时间缩短。仅在佩戴TRD半晚的第一晚,阻塞性和中枢性呼吸暂停发作次数就显著减少。佩戴TRD时的平均呼吸暂停加低通气指数与接受气管切开术或悬雍垂腭咽成形术手术治疗的患者报告的比率相当,尽管气管切开术组包含更多重症病例。
